The size of Tumbarumba is approximately 231.7 square kilometres. There are 6 parks, covering nearly 48.4% of the total area. The population of Tumbarumba in 2016 was 1862 people. By 2021 the population was 1915 showing a population growth of 2.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tumbarumba is 60-69 years. Households in Tumbarumba are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tumbarumba work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 70.80% of the homes in Tumbarumba were owner-occupied compared with 68.70% in 2016.
